ROWETT’S BUTLAND PLEA

- BY DAVID ANDERSON

STOKE boss Gary Rowett will call Jack Butland this weekend to say he wants him to stay and help City’s bid for an immediate return to the Premier League.

Rowett is under no financial pressure to sell his England World Cup goalkeeper and will appeal to him to follow Joe Allen’s lead by committing his future to the Potters.

“I said I’d leave him alone for now as he’s concentrat­ing on a massive tournament,” said Rowett.

“But I think I’ll give him a call over the weekend now the group stage is out of the way.

“You want to spend five or 10 minutes trying to gauge the situation of all the players and where you see them.

“Because Jack is a terrific goalkeeper and obviously with England at the moment everyone will speculate that because you’ve been relegated, of course he’s going to have to go, he’s going to want to go.

“But the reality is – you’ve seen it with Joe Allen and others – people want to be at this club.”
